Texas Hill Country Bass Club Bylaws

Texas Hill Country

Founded in 2009

ARTICLE I – Name, Purpose, Meetings and Awards

Section 1: Name

This club shall be called "Texas Hill Country Bass Club"

Section 2: Purpose

A: To have fun, enjoy and promote the sport of bass fishing.

B: To share knowledge and information.

C: promote good sportsmanship and set a good example for all other

fishermen and fisherwomen.

D: To conserve and preserve our natural resources.

Section 3 Meetings

A: Club meetings will be held on the first Tuesday of each month at 7:00 pm

At 832 Sidney Baker in Kerrville TX 78028 until such time that a new location

can be chosen.

Section 4 Awards

A: The club will provide the following end of the year awards.

1: Big Bass (Fiberglass replica)

2: Angler of the year.

3: Most improved

ARTICLE II - Membership

Section 1: Membership Requirements

A: Must be at least 18 years of age unless a parent, grandparent or legal

Guardian is an active member in good standing. Then minimum age will be

16 years of age for adult division.

B: Applicants must express an interest in club membership. Then must be

recognized by two members in good standing at a regular club meeting. Club

dues will then be paid.

C: New members after a two month probation period will be voted in by a

secret ballet of 2/3 vote of membership at that meeting. If not voted in

all of applicants money for due is refunded.

D: New members must attend all meetings in the probation period. With

The exception of one month will be granted due to extenuating circumstances.

During this time prospective member cannot vote on club business.

E: Dues must be paid in full before first tournament of the year is fished. If

not paid person or persons will need to be re-voted in. New member’s dues will

be pro-rated after the 4 month of the fiscal year.

Section 2: Membership Dues

A: Membership dues shall be $50.00 annually. And shall cover all house hold

Members, (wife and children)

B: Fiscal year is September to September.

C: Dues are due September meeting.

D: All dues go into general fund for club business

ARTICLE III – Officers, Elections, Vacancies, and Eligibility to hold office

Section 1: Eligibility To Hold Office

A: Must be a member in good standing for at least 6 months.

B: Must have attended 75% of club functions during the year.

C: Except for start up of club.

Section 2: Elections

A: The elections will be held at the last regular meeting of September

And new officers will take office at first meeting of October.

B: All elections will be on a simple majority of the membership present.

C: Each member of the club in good standing is entitled to one vote. Proxy

Votes are not permitted.

Section 3: Term In Office

A: The term of officers is for one fiscal year unless re-voted in for another year

There are no term limits.

Section 4: Vacancies

A: In event of an office becomes vacant Officers will appoint a member for

The remainder of the year if not a officer may be ask to fill 2 positions for the

remainder of that fiscal year.

Section 5: Officers and their Duties

The officers of the chapter shall consist of:

A: PRESIDENT: Preside over all meetings and direct all official business.

Appoint and be an ex officio member of all committees. Supervise all clubs

Functions.

B: VICE PRESIDENT: Act as club programs chairman. Assist the President

In his or hers duties and preside in the absence of the President and will

Be a permanent tournament director.

C: SECRETARY: Maintain accurate minutes of all regular and special

Meetings as called for by the club President.

D: TREASURER: Collect and disburse all monies. Maintain accurate financial

Records and present a current balance report at each regular meeting.

Prepare an annual audit for review by the club board of directors.

E: CLUB CONSERVATION OFFICER: Serve as liaison between the club and

State and national conservation agencies. Plan club conservation projects and

Will serve as Lake Researcher and adviser for 6 lakes to bring to the club

meeting where the club will then pick 4 lakes for 3 months 3lakes 1 backup.

F: CLUB YOUTH DIRECTOR: Organize all youth activities and programs and

Start a junior angler’s club when the club is ready for this participation.

H: CORRIDNATOR: This job is to coordinate hotels and help with setting up

Activities of the club.

ARTICLE IV - Disciplinary actions

Section 1: Removal of Membership

A: Membership shall be dropped for the following reasons:

1: Failure to pay dues.

2: Any action which would dishonor and disgrace on the club.

3: Disqualification for any reason from participating in sponsored events

Including disqualification for the use of illegal drugs or alcohol.

Section 2: Actions other then removal of membership

A: These actions shall be recommended by the Officer and board of directors

And shall include but not limited to reduction of membership status in lieu

Of removal, or any other action felt necessary by the board. Any action

Recommended by the Board and not spelled out in this document shall require

A 2/3 vote of the Board of Directors.

Section 3: Membership Recall

Any membership can be recalled by a 2/3 majority vote of the membership

at any time for any reason.

ARTICLE V By laws

A: By laws may be added to during the year.

1: Submitted in writing at meeting, discussed and voted on by 2/3 majority at next meeting.

B: Amendments to by laws.

1: Submitted in writing by August, discussed and voted on by 2/3 majority at September meeting.

ARTICLE VI- SCALES

Scales owned by David Springer and will be leased by the club for $10.00 a year

The club is responsible for all damage, upkeep and maintenance of scales. If for any

Reason David Springer leaves the club the club has 1 year to buy their own.

ARTICLE VII- TOURNAMENTS

A: The Texas Hill Country Bass Club will have 11 tournaments per calendar year. There will not be a tournament in December. There may be only one paper tournament per year. This tournament when held will but not count on your official yearend totals and will be for bragging rights and pay out only. The tournament will be known as The Biggest Liar Tournament.

B: The final tournament will be known as THE CHARLES HAUCK MEMORIAL TOURNAMENT.

C: 3 month rule applies on all tournaments.

D: 30 day off limits (on final only) No one is allowed on that lake for 30 days.

E: To qualify (on final only) a member must do- 1 function, 6 tournaments, and 7 meeting.

ARTICLE VIII – DISSOLVING THE CLUB

A: If the club decides to dissolve. Must be voted on with all membership present,(cool heads prevail).

B: A 2/3 vote is required.

C: All club debts are to be paid with all end funds to be sent to clubs main recipient

of charity. (red cross, pathways or salvation army)
